Output 153a1cd132ce8be76c939c1e01e9eae80728c84a44e727620ff135d0fa812838:0

value
268259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c7a26c05f80e12fbc9edf936aa39e04448a814 OP_EQUAL
address
3B4TzxQ81yw2gvD8vJCsGjatnhP6ppMuf8
transaction
153a1cd132ce8be76c939c1e01e9eae80728c84a44e727620ff135d0fa812838